**Alert: Meridian billing worker — blue-green cutover stalled**

The green stack for the Meridian billing worker has not passed health checks within the expected window, and traffic remains pinned to blue. Invoices are still processing, but the deploy is blocked. Check warm-up logs before retrying or rolling back. The cutover runbook is maintained on the internal page below.

wiki page, bagaf-fawip: https://harbor.tolvaqsys.local/pages/repo/pages/secrets/eac969ffc71f356b

Subject: Warranty costs on the Durlan 9 line — heads up

Team, quick flag before the sales calls this week: warranty claims on the Durlan 9 compressor units are running well over forecast, mostly seal failures from the Kettleby plant batch. It's eating into margin faster than we'd like, so please don't lead with extended-warranty upsells until engineering signs off on the fix. Keep messaging upbeat but don't overpromise turnaround times. How we're handling this strategically is covered in the confidential note below.

board note of fahif-yahog: Gross margin on Wenath came in at 10 percent against a plan of 5 percent. Only 3 of the 100 pilot accounts renewed Wenath, so a churn review is set for July 15.

## Action Item: Build Agent Clock Skew

Context for new folks: the Oakhollow incident was caused by clock skew between Tindervale build agents. Artifacts got stamped out of order, the cache served stale layers, and two releases shipped with old binaries. Root cause: NTP sync disabled on three agents after reimaging. Fix: skew checks now run pre-build and fail hard past threshold. Do not override without sign-off from Marja. Agents failing twice get quarantined automatically. The enforced limits are listed below.

tuning constants:
QUOTAS = {
    "druwyn": 5,
    "holix": 5,
    "zorath": 5,
    "holwyn": 10,
}

### Account Recovery — Catalogue Import (Lintwood)

Quick one for review: when the Lintwood catalogue import wipes a patron's session table, the recovery flow re-seeds accounts from the nightly snapshot. Check that the importer skips locked accounts — last time it didn't. To rerun recovery against staging you'll need the vault passphrase, which is appended just below.

recovery phrase for yafof-tajof: julmir-kelax-julvan-holath-belvan-holir-ralael-ralvan-ralath-julvan-silmir-istmir-kaswyn-ulamir